DRASSINOWER H., Enrique. Reacción constitucional producida por el extracto de polvo de casa. Rev. perú. med. exp. salud publica [online]. 1951, vol.8, n.1-4, pp.194-214. ISSN 1726-4634.

1° A general exposition of the house dust has been made, showing that it belongs to the non-seasonal inhalants. It has been remarked that in our Country, house dust is the most important inhalant and the most frequent responsible of the allergic diseases of the respiratory tract. 2° House dust's composition has been exposed and it was remarked that its antigenic activity does not depend on the inhalants that compose it, but upon a specific factor highly antigenic of unknown nature. 3° We believe that house dust actually possesses an antigenic action, and that this activity is due to a specific factor. 4° It was mentioned that there are many prooves in favour of these two principles (one of the most important is the PRAUSNITZ-KÜSTNERS method), but only personal observations are exposed: The good clinical results that have been obtained in our country during the desensitization treatment with autogens and stock or mixed house dust extracts. During the comparative study made with house dust extracts from New York City and autogen and stock house dust extracts from our city, the same clinical results (diagnosis as well as treatment) were obtained. This suggests that the antigenic activity of house dust depends upon a specific factor that might be present in the three extracts. Finally, it was exposed that a definite proove in favour of he antigenic activity of house dust, is the constitutional reaction produced by its extract. It was remarked that these kind of reactions with house dust extract are very unusual. 5° Two clinical cases of constitutional reactions produced with house dust extracts during desensitization treatment are reported. 6° The circunstances of the appearing of the constitutional reactions and the dosis with which they were produced in both cases, are completely different and even opposed. In the first case the constitutional reaction was produced in the beginning of the treatment and with a very low dosis: 0.15 cc. of the 1/10 solution of house dust extract. The highest dosis tolerated was 0.14 cc. from the same solution. This is a case of constitutional reaction due to an extremely hypersensitiveness to house dust. In the second case the constitutional reaction was produced with a higher dosis (0.23 cc. and 0.25 cc. of the concentrated solution) and under the circunstances that we were getting to the maintaining dosis. The highest dosis tolerated was 0.2 cc. of the concentrated solution. This is a case of constitutional reaction due to a high maintaining dosis. 7° In both cases a reproduction of the symptomatology of the dominant allergic disease (bronchial asthma) was observed during the constitutional reactions. 8° In both cases it was possible to produce constitutional reactions with autogen house dust extracts as well as with stock extracts. 9° These are the first cases reported in our country of constitutional reactions produced with house dust extracts, and we are considering this as a contribution in favour of the antigenic activity of house dust.
